Scale Drawings of the Peach Bottom Railway Vol. 1 & 2

Scale Drawings of the Peach Bottom Railway,

Volume 1 and Volume 2—New—Revised and Combined Edition

By Stanley T. White

Scale Drawings of the Peach Bottom Railway Volume 1 was first published in 2005. Volume 2 followed in 2006. The revised “combo” version by Stanley T. White, copyright 2016, includes corrections in the drawings and updates some information in the various articles about the buildings along the Peach Bottom Railway, or “Little, Old & Slow”.

The 69 page book is spiral bound 8 1/2” x 11” and contains articles and color photographs, as well as detailed drawings of structures along the railroad and railroad equipment. Care was taken to print the drawings to the chosen scale used (which varies depending on the size of the subject).
